How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Santa Fe Springs?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Santa Fe Springs Studio Apartments | $1,958 | $1,450 | $2,741 |
| Santa Fe Springs 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,346 | $1,600 | $4,184 |
Santa Fe Springs 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,901 | $1,995 | $4,995 |
| Santa Fe Springs 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,338 | $2,650 | $4,350 |

Frequently Asked Questions about 2 Bedroom Santa Fe Springs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in Santa Fe Springs with 2 Bedroom?
Currently the most affordable 2 Bedroom in Santa Fe Springs is at 14125 Coteau Dr listed at $2,195.
How much is the average rent for a 2 Bedroom Santa Fe Springs Apartment?
The average rent for a 2 Bedroom Apartment in Santa Fe Springs is $2,901.
What is the largest available 2 Bedroom Santa Fe Springs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Santa Fe Springs is a 1,273 square feet unit starting from $4,087 at Aria.
What is the average size for Santa Fe Springs 2 Bedroom Apartments for rent?
The average size for a 2 Bedroom rental in Santa Fe Springs is currently 906 sq ft.
